Are you passionate about making a difference in the lives of young learners?

We are a welcoming Church of England primary school, part of a dynamic multi academy trust, dedicated to providing a nurturing and inclusive environment for all our pupils.

We are currently seeking a dedicated and enthusiastic Learning Support Assistant (LSA) to join our team from September 2026.

In this role, you will work closely with pupils who have special educational needs, providing support to help them thrive academically, socially, and emotionally.

Your commitment and enthusiasm will play a crucial part in fostering a positive learning experience.

This is a temporary position for one academic year, offering a unique opportunity to contribute to our school’s mission and make a meaningful impact within our community.
